What to see near Demre
Church of St. Nicholas β The Byzantine church in Demre where Saint Nicholas β the original Santa Claus β served as bishop and was buried. Myra Rock Tombs β A cliff face honeycombed with elaborate Lycian house-style tombs, above a well-preserved Roman theatre. Andriake / Myra Museum β The ancient harbour of Myra with a granary of Hadrian and a museum of Lycian civilisation. Kekova Sunken City β Submerged ancient ruins reached by boat from nearby ΓΓ§aΔΔ±z, on the shore of Kekova island.
Local tips
β’ Visit the Church of St. Nicholas and the Myra tombs together β they are minutes apart. β’ Kekova boats leave from ΓΓ§aΔΔ±z/Andriake near Demre, not from the town centre. β’ Demre is inland of its beaches; allow extra time to reach the harbour.
From our team on the ground
A short, punchy off-road buggy ride through hills, villages and mountain tracks β about two hours including a stop, so it slots easily into a half day. It's dusty by nature; wear sunglasses, closed shoes and clothes you don't mind getting dirty, and bring a buff or scarf for your face on dry tracks. Drivers get a quick briefing first; basic control is enough, no experience needed. Best for couples and groups wanting a fun adrenaline hit without a full-day commitment.
